Orkut Gmail Agenda Docs Web mais »
Grupos visitados recentemente | Ajuda | Acessar
Página inicial dos Grupos do Google
Coisa estranha no session->flash()
Há um número excessivo de tópicos que aparecem em primeiro plano neste grupo. Para fazer com que este tópico apareça primeiro, elimine essa opção de um outro tópico.
Erro ao processar a solicitação. Tente novamente.
sinalizar
  8 mensagens - Recolher todas  -  Traduzir tudo para Traduzido (ver todos os originais)
O grupo no qual você está postando é um grupo da Usenet. As mensagens postadas neste grupo farão com que o seu e-mail fique visível para qualquer pessoa na internet.
Sua resposta não foi enviada.
Postagem publicada
 
De:
Para:
Cc:
Encaminhar para
Adicionar Cc | Adicionar Encaminhar para | Editar Assunto
Assunto:
Validação:
Com o objetivo de verificação, digite os caracteres que você vê na figura abaixo ou os números que ouvir ao clicar no ícone de acessibilidade. Ouça e digite os números que ouvir
 
Pedro Valmor  
Ver perfil   Traduzir para Traduzido (ver original)
 Mais opções 3 nov, 17:55
De: Pedro Valmor <pedroval...@gmail.com>
Data: Tue, 03 Nov 2009 17:55:42 -0200
Local: Ter 3 nov 2009 17:55
Assunto: Coisa estranha no session->flash()
Olá,

Boa tarde a todos os desenvolvedores aew...

Estou setando o método da classe Session assim na action de um
Controller qqr:

function add(){
        $this->layout = 'Site';
        if (!empty($this->data)) {
            if ($this->Newsletter->save($this->data)) {
                $this->Session->setFlash('Adicionado!');
                $this->redirect(array('controller'=>'sites'
,'action'=>'index'));
            }
        }
    }

E depois na View recupero assim:

echo $session->flash();

Mas volta com um número inteiro "1", sempre fica abaixo da mensagem de
"Adicionado", alguém já passou por isso?

Ex:

<br/>
<div id="flashMessage" class="message">Adicionado!</div>
1
<br/>

inclusive acontece com todas as outras msgs que uso... como deletar,
atualizado, etc...  Alguém pode me ajudar por favor? Obrigado!

--

[]s

Pedro Valmor


    Responder    Responder ao autor    Encaminhar  
É necessário Acessar antes de postar mensagens.
Para postar uma mensagem você precisa primeiro participar deste grupo.
Atualize seu apelido na página de configurações da inscrição antes de postar.
Você não tem a permissão necessária para postar.
Gabriel Gilini  
Ver perfil   Traduzir para Traduzido (ver original)
 Mais opções 6 nov, 11:07
De: Gabriel Gilini <gabr...@usosim.com.br>
Data: Fri, 6 Nov 2009 11:07:03 -0200
Local: Sex 6 nov 2009 11:07
Assunto: Re: [CakePHP-Tuga] Coisa estranha no session->flash()
2009/11/3 Pedro Valmor <pedroval...@gmail.com>:

A função flash do SessionHelper já dá echo e retorna um booleano que
indica sucesso. O que tá acontecendo é que o echo faz uma conversão
implícita desse `true', e exibe "1" sempre que você chama a função :)

http://api.cakephp.org/class/session-helper#method-SessionHelperflash

--
Gabriel Gilini

www.usosim.com.br
gabr...@usosim.com.br


    Responder    Responder ao autor    Encaminhar  
É necessário Acessar antes de postar mensagens.
Para postar uma mensagem você precisa primeiro participar deste grupo.
Atualize seu apelido na página de configurações da inscrição antes de postar.
Você não tem a permissão necessária para postar.
Pedro Barros de Miranda Sobrinho  
Ver perfil   Traduzir para Traduzido (ver original)
 Mais opções 6 nov, 10:07
De: Pedro Barros de Miranda Sobrinho <pedro...@gmail.com>
Data: Fri, 6 Nov 2009 10:07:47 -0200
Local: Sex 6 nov 2009 10:07
Assunto: Re: [CakePHP-Tuga] Coisa estranha no session->flash()

Amigo tira o "echo"!

Use apenas <? $session->flash('flash');?>

Pedro

2009/11/3 Pedro Valmor <pedroval...@gmail.com>


    Responder    Responder ao autor    Encaminhar  
É necessário Acessar antes de postar mensagens.
Para postar uma mensagem você precisa primeiro participar deste grupo.
Atualize seu apelido na página de configurações da inscrição antes de postar.
Você não tem a permissão necessária para postar.
Pedro Valmor  
Ver perfil   Traduzir para Traduzido (ver original)
 Mais opções 6 nov, 11:18
De: Pedro Valmor <pedroval...@gmail.com>
Data: Fri, 06 Nov 2009 11:18:11 -0200
Local: Sex 6 nov 2009 11:18
Assunto: Re: [CakePHP-Tuga] Re: Coisa estranha no session->flash()
Obrigado!

[]s

Pedro Valmor

Gabriel Gilini escreveu:


    Responder    Responder ao autor    Encaminhar  
É necessário Acessar antes de postar mensagens.
Para postar uma mensagem você precisa primeiro participar deste grupo.
Atualize seu apelido na página de configurações da inscrição antes de postar.
Você não tem a permissão necessária para postar.
Mauro George  
Ver perfil   Traduzir para Traduzido (ver original)
 Mais opções 6 nov, 17:51
De: Mauro George <mauro...@gmail.com>
Data: Fri, 6 Nov 2009 11:51:54 -0800 (PST)
Local: Sex 6 nov 2009 17:51
Assunto: Re: Coisa estranha no session->flash()
Ola, eu sou novo no cakePHP e aqui na comunidade também.
Já segui alguns tutoriais, estou entendo a lógica do cake e tal.
No entanto, o setFlah nunca exibe nada na minha view, fiz o exemplo
igual do tutorial do blog do proprio cake. A operação funciona,
adicionar, exculir..., no entanto o flash não.

Alguem sabe o motivo? Tem que colocar algo na view do default.ctp, ou
criar uma view.ctp?

On 6 nov, 11:07, Gabriel Gilini <gabr...@usosim.com.br> wrote:


    Responder    Responder ao autor    Encaminhar  
É necessário Acessar antes de postar mensagens.
Para postar uma mensagem você precisa primeiro participar deste grupo.
Atualize seu apelido na página de configurações da inscrição antes de postar.
Você não tem a permissão necessária para postar.
Thiago de Oliveira  
Ver perfil   Traduzir para Traduzido (ver original)
 Mais opções 7 nov, 03:38
De: Thiago de Oliveira <thiago.ho...@gmail.com>
Data: Sat, 7 Nov 2009 03:38:20 -0200
Local: Sab 7 nov 2009 03:38
Assunto: Re: [CakePHP-Tuga] Re: Coisa estranha no session->flash()

*
*
Olá Gabriel!

Estou com o mesmo problema, esse 1 senvergonha tava me dexando loco

Sou mais um fam teu!

brigadão

2009/11/6 Gabriel Gilini <gabr...@usosim.com.br>


    Responder    Responder ao autor    Encaminhar  
É necessário Acessar antes de postar mensagens.
Para postar uma mensagem você precisa primeiro participar deste grupo.
Atualize seu apelido na página de configurações da inscrição antes de postar.
Você não tem a permissão necessária para postar.
Mauro George  
Ver perfil   Traduzir para Traduzido (ver original)
 Mais opções 8 nov, 15:03
De: Mauro George <mauro...@gmail.com>
Data: Sun, 8 Nov 2009 09:03:14 -0800 (PST)
Local: Dom 8 nov 2009 15:03
Assunto: Re: Coisa estranha no session->flash()
Estou passando pelo mesmo problema. Sou iniciante no CakePHP e nem
sabia como exibir o SetFlash na view. Agora estou exbindo e faço assim
e( $session->flash() ); no entanto no inicio não estava o numero 1 lá
ou eu não reparei mais agora esta aparecendo exatamente como você
falou:

<div id="flashMessage" class="message">Comentário Salvo!</div>
1

Sera que algum sabe resolver?

On 3 nov, 17:55, Pedro Valmor <pedroval...@gmail.com> wrote:


    Responder    Responder ao autor    Encaminhar  
É necessário Acessar antes de postar mensagens.
Para postar uma mensagem você precisa primeiro participar deste grupo.
Atualize seu apelido na página de configurações da inscrição antes de postar.
Você não tem a permissão necessária para postar.
Mauro George  
Ver perfil   Traduzir para Traduzido (ver original)
 Mais opções 8 nov, 15:10
De: Mauro George <mauro...@gmail.com>
Data: Sun, 8 Nov 2009 09:10:24 -0800 (PST)
Local: Dom 8 nov 2009 15:10
Assunto: Re: Coisa estranha no session->flash()
Obrigado Gabriel estava com a mesma duvida e fui pesquisar, resumindo
não necessita dar echo $session->flash(); e sim $session->flash();.
Achei na url abaixo

http://stackoverflow.com/questions/1402912/cakephp-flash-messages-dis...

Um abraço e obrigado

On 6 nov, 11:07, Gabriel Gilini <gabr...@usosim.com.br> wrote:


    Responder    Responder ao autor    Encaminhar  
É necessário Acessar antes de postar mensagens.
Para postar uma mensagem você precisa primeiro participar deste grupo.
Atualize seu apelido na página de configurações da inscrição antes de postar.
Você não tem a permissão necessária para postar.
Fim das mensagens
« Voltar às Discussões « Tópico recente     Tópico antigo »

Criar um grupo - Grupos do Google - Página inicial do Google - Termos de Uso - Política de Privacidade
©2009 Google